Personal Statement

During the Covid 19 pandemic I spent the entire winter training on my batting skills at the local batting cages. During these training sessions Coach Neil Head Varsity Baseball Coach at the MacDuffie School recruited me to play my Junior/Senior year at the school. Even tho all my other sports were shut down during the Pandemic I was able to figure out a way to continue my baseball training by going to the local batting cages. During my 2 years at public high school, I lettered in 4 varsity sports Soccer, Basketball, Baseball, Volleyball and AAU baseball. It was an extremely difficult decision to leave my high school in my junior year, but I wanted to reinvent myself and better prepare academically for college. I also knew MacDuffie would allow me to play High School Baseball at higher level and compete against Prep School athletes.  I have been told I am one of the fastest athletes around and all of my High School coaches always complemented my speed and athleticism.  I lettered in 3 sports as a freshman, voted first team Western Ma for Volleyball and played AAU Baseball at a high level including top regional tournaments.  I was recently voted to be the Team Captain for the MacDuffie Baseball Team.

Biggest Game of the season NEPSAC Semi Final playoff game I hit an in the Park Home Run. The hit scored 3 Runs to take the team to the NEPSAC Championship Game. At the NEPSAC Quarter Final Game, I had 2 hits, single, double for a 3 RBI game. It was a clutch/pressure double to put team ahead and lead us to victory and advance our Team to the NEPSCA Quarter Finals. During the 2022 NEPSAC Baseball Tournament I had a team high 6 RBI’s. I am a multiple sport Athlete. I am the quickest kid on the team running a 3.8 to first base. Historically I am always the quickest player on the team for all the teams I played for throughout my career.
